c - 如何使用 tcp/ip 向客户端发送二维数组;我的代码什么也没打印
问题描述
************服务器*********
char arr[20][20];
int i,j;
for(i=0;i<20;i++){
for(j=0;j<20;j++){
send(sock,&arr[i][j],sizeof(char),0);
}
}
*******客户***************************
char arr[20][20];
int i,j;
for(i=0;i<20;i++){
for(j=0;j<20;j++){
recv(sock,&arr[i][j],sizeof(char),0);
printf("%s",arr[i][j]);
}
}
解决方案
推荐阅读
- reactjs - ReactNative + TypeScript + WebStorm - 调试不起作用
- apache - Asp 经典未终止字符串常量
- jquery - JQuery Mobile 如何使用 TouchPunch.js 在页面上移动元素?
- sql - 查询非规范化表
- r - 根据闪亮的 dateRangeInput() 设置折线图的 x 轴
- java - 添加方法和 while 循环无法正确执行
- c# - 我怎样才能有一个随机数而没有相同的
- c# - 在同步等待方法中,图像属性不与 UI 绑定
- c# - 如何写入现有的txt文件c#
- javascript - 在自定义框架中使用由 babeljs.io 和 webpack 生成的 javascript ES6 代码